Moultrops Service. This Mobilgas station was a combination grocery store and automobile service station. The tiny building was decorated with a variety of signs - Coca Cola, Shelton Maid ice cream, Mobilgas, Goodrich tires & batteries. Cabins were available for rental, steps away from the station. The service station and cabin (s) are still in existence on what is now called Golden Pheasant Rd., south of Shelton, and on the way to Isabella Lake. (Additional information provided by a reader)
